Market Movements: Biotech and AI Drive Stock Surges Amid Selective Downgrades
Biotech and artificial intelligence sectors dominated Tuesday’s market action as regulatory catalysts and strategic acquisitions fueled double-digit rallies. Allarity Therapeutics vaulted 78% on FDA Fast Track designation for its ovarian cancer therapy, while Serina Therapeutics gained 42% following positive FDA feedback for its Parkinson’s treatment candidate.
Vertiv Holdings surged 12% after acquiring generative AI specialist Waylay NV, signaling intensifying competition in enterprise AI infrastructure. The quantum computing race accelerated as IBM and AMD climbed 4.3% and 3.1% respectively on their new partnership, coinciding with IBM’s Australian government cloud contract win.
Not all news spurred optimism. American Eagle slid 6.2% after Bank of America’s downgrade, highlighting retail sector vulnerability. Joby Aviation defied insider selling concerns to rise 3.4%, though the $7.2 million disposal casts shadows on eVTOL adoption timelines.
